    The Appeal of Dice-Based Randomness

    At its core, Sic Bo revolves around three dice and the countless ways their totals and combinations can land. Players wager on specific numbers, sums, or pairings, and the outcome is settled the moment the dice come to rest.

    This directness resonates with people who prefer to see the source of chance rather than trust an unseen algorithm.

    The visible roll removes ambiguity, and that transparency builds a sense of fairness. Several traits explain why dice-based randomness holds such lasting appeal:

    • Immediate resolution: Every roll settles instantly, so players never wait through drawn-out stages to learn the result.
    • Transparent outcomes: The physical dice make the source of chance plain to see, reinforcing trust in a fair result.
    • Broad betting range: Options span low-risk wagers with modest returns to rare combinations that pay far more generously.
    • Suits every temperament: Cautious and adventurous players can both find satisfying choices within the same round.

    Betting Structure and Player Choice

    Understanding the layout of a Sic Bo table clarifies why it retains such broad appeal. The board presents numerous positions, and each carries its own probability and payout profile.

    Newer players often gravitate toward simpler bets, while experienced participants may distribute stakes across several positions to shape their own risk balance. This flexibility keeps the game engaging across different sessions and budgets.

    The following overview highlights common bet categories and their general character, offering a sense of how choices differ in frequency and reward without implying any guaranteed result.

    Bet Type General Frequency Reward Character
    Big or Small Occurs often Modest, steady
    Specific Total Varies by number Moderate to high
    Single Number Fairly common Low but frequent
    Triple (any) Rare High payout

    Because these categories coexist on one table, players can adjust their approach round to round. That freedom to shift between conservative and bold wagers sustains interest far longer than a format with only one or two options.
